UVA Radiology Earns Accolades at 2026 Radiology Conferences

May 18, 2026 by Henry Lin-David   |   Leave a Comment

Former and current members of UVA Radiology convened earlier this year at the Society of Interventional Radiology’s annual meeting in Toronto.

It’s been a busy first half of 2026 for the University of Virginia’s Department of Radiology and Medical Imaging! UVA members traveled across the nation for events including the Society of Skeletal Radiology’s Annual Meeting, the Association of Academic Radiology’s Annual Meeting, the Society of Interventional Radiology’s Annual Scientific Meeting, and the Society of Breast Imaging Symposium – delivering lectures, participating in panels, and earning accolades.

Keep reading to learn more about the department’s notable activities around North America.


Society of Skeletal Radiology (March 7-11, Huntington Beach, CA)

MSK fellow Sean Rodich, MD, delivering a presentation on blastomycosis which won a “Case of the Day” award.

Members of the MSK Division headed to the SSR’s annual meeting in Huntington Beach, CA, where MSK fellow Sean Rodich, MD, won the “Case of the Day” award for his presentation on blastomycosis. Next year’s meeting will be organized with the help of Professor Kirk Davis, MD, who is now the SSR President-Elect!


Association of Academic Radiology (March 17-20 in Atlanta, GA)

Professor Arun Krishnaraj, MD, MPH, delivering the keynote lecture at the Association of Academic Radiology’s annual meeting.

In March, department members attended the annual AAR meeting in Atlanta. There, Professor Arun Krishnaraj, MD, MPH, delivered a keynote lecture titled “Bridging Generations in Radiology: Embracing Diversity for a Stronger Future,” featuring panelists including Professor Juliana Bueno, MD, and chief residents Kristen Reeder, MD, and Eric J. Fromke, MD. Professor Alan H. Matsumoto, MD, MA, also gave a presentation in his role as ACR president.


Society of Interventional Radiology (April 11-15 in Toronto, Canada)

A portion of the members of UVA Radiology’s Division of Vascular and Interventional Radiology who were in attendance at the SIR’s annual meeting.

Members of UVA IR took part in a variety of presentations, poster sessions, and panels during the SIR’s Annual Scientific Meeting. Participants from UVA’s IR-Integrated Residency include Andrew Ray, MD (PGY-6, chief resident), Amy Crumb, MD (PGY-5), Christina Dalzell, MD (PGY-4), Warren Campbell IV, MD, PhD (PGY-3), and Sunny Murthy, MD, MS (PGY-2). More than half of the department’s IR faculty contributed to the meeting, including J. Fritz Angle, MD, Ziv Haskal, MD, Alan Matsumoto, MD, MA, Daniel Sheeran, MD, Amy Taylor, MD, MBA, and Luke Wilkins, MD.

Other highlights: Dr. Angle was presented with the SIR’s inaugural Barry T. Katzen Master Clinician Award (which you can read more about here). Plus, a faculty team of Drs. Angle, Sheeran, Taylor, and Wilkins along with Associate Professor John Matson, MD, put UVA teamwork on full display, winning the Sunday IR Escape Room with their team named “Hoos on Call” and earning complimentary registration to the SIR 2027 Annual Meeting!


Society of Breast Imaging (April 16-19 in Seattle, Washington)

Julia Kim, MD, was honored on screens throughout the conference for being one of two Electronic Abstracts Winners.

At the 2026 SBI Breast Imaging Symposium, UVA Radiology resident Julia Kim, MD, was one of two winners for “Best Electronic Abstract.” Her presentation, titled “In the Shadows of Contrast: False Negatives on Contrast Enhanced Mammography,” was chosen from more than 400 submissions. Afterwards, Dr. Kim’s work was lauded in front of thousands of international radiology attendees during the main hall plenary sessions and on signage throughout the meeting.
